  • Adding OSB to Pre-built SOA OSB BPM (PS5) VM - WC_Spaces template

    Hi,
    I have downloaded and setup the pre-built developer VM for SOA/OSB/BPM using the Webcenter Spaces template. Everything works fine, I am just trying to add OSB to extend the existing domain but getting stuck at the wizard where it asks for the OSB JMS Reporting Provider JDBC connection properties. The steps to get there are as follows:
    Extend SOA domain
    * Start Configuration Wizard:
    cd /opt/oracle/Middleware/home_11gr1/Oracle_OSB1/common/bin
    ./config.sh
    * Select Extend an existing WebLogic domain, click Next
    * On Select a WebLogic Domain Directory screen, select soa_domain
    * On Select Extension Source screen,
    - Select: Oracle Service Bus [Oracle_OSB1]
    - Select: Oracle Service Bus OWSM Extenstion [Oracle_OSB1]
    - WebLogic Advanced Web Services for JAX-RPC Extension [wlserver_10.3] option is also automatically selected.
    - Click Next
    * On Configure JDBC Data Sources screen, select soademoDatabase which was created at SOA Suite install. Click Next.
    * Test JDBC Data Sources, click Next when successful
    * On Configure JDBC Component Schema, select the checkbox for OSB JMS Reporting Provider and enter
    - Vendor: Oracle
    - Driver: *Oracle's Driver (Thin) for Service connections; Versions:9.0.1 and later
    - Schema Owner: DEV_SOAINFRA
    - Schema Password: welcome1
    - DBMS/Service: orcl.world
    - Host Name: localhost
    - Port: 1521
    - Click Next ======> Can't get past here since OSB JMS Reporting Provider database cannot be found!!
    Wondering if there is a way to use the initial setup script to add OSB JMS Reporting Provider DB? I also couldn't find RCU Home so that I could add the OSB JMS Reporting Provider DB to the XE Instance. Any help is much appreciated..
    Thanks
    Z.
    Edited by: 956060 on Aug 30, 2012 8:18 AM

    * On Configure JDBC Data Sources screen, select soademoDatabase which was created at SOA Suite install. Click Next.You may skip this step by not selecting anything. Later on when you need to work with Reporting, you may create a data-source and tables manually.
    And at the next startup of the Admin Server it complains about the JDBC connection not available and fails to initialize it.To avoid this problem, you may follow below steps -
    1. Navigate to directory $Domain_Home/config
    2. Search for string "wlsbjmsrpDataSource" in file config.xml
    3. You will find an entry like below -
    <jdbc-system-resource>
    <name>wlsbjmsrpDataSource</name>
    <target>AdminServer</target>
    <descriptor-file-name>jdbc/wlsbjmsrpDataSource-jdbc.xml</descriptor-file-name>
    </jdbc-system-resource>
    Replace the above entry with below -
    <jdbc-system-resource>
    <name>wlsbjmsrpDataSource</name>
    <target></target>
    <descriptor-file-name>jdbc/wlsbjmsrpDataSource-jdbc.xml</descriptor-file-name>
    </jdbc-system-resource>
    Basically you need to remove the targeting of this DS. Once done, save the config.xml and try to start your admin server now.
    When (in future) you want to use Reporting feature of OSB, just provide the details of DB in the connection pool of datasource "wlsbjmsrpDataSource" and target it to the OSB servers and you will be good to go.

    I've imported this appliance (and others) on Windows 7 32-bit on a Lenovo W500, on an iMac, and on a MacBook. The one error you should encounter during the "import appliance" step is a path error related to shared folder (the canned/hard-coded path in the ovf file points to a place that is not likely to exist on your computer, so just comment out the D:\TEMP\Host path, or make it for that matter).
    <!--SharedFolders-->
    <!--SharedFolder name="Host" hostPath="D:\TEMP\Host" writable="false" autoMount="true"/ -->
    <!-- /SharedFolders-->
    You can alter system set memory_target=300M scope=both and set your VM memory to 2.5GB and everything will run fine (using the vmctl script to start up what's needed). The "1" option is all that is needed for the tutorial shown in the documentation. If you run the admin server, you will see things run a good bit slower. Part of the tutorial assumes you know about UCM and how to take the UCM content in the sample files and upload those into the repository. You can delete the file already loaded and then do a single file upload to "re-load" the various directories/folders for the menu/home/etc. Upload the png and other files into the same folder (menu.html, menuBanner.png, etc. all go into the same Menu folder). It's not worth the time to set the bulk upload because you have to go out into UCM and dig around the admin settings, stop/restart, and so on. You can also use the contentadmin user (welcome1) to do the file upload.
